What is a B Pharma Course?
The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harm) is a 4-year undergraduate program spanning 8 semesters, designed to train students in pharmaceutical sciences. It covers drug formulation, pharmacology, medicinal chemistry, and pharmacognosy, preparing graduates for roles in healthcare, research, and industry.
The curriculum integrates theoretical learning with practical training, including lab work, internships, and industry visits.
In Uttar Pradesh, the B Pharma course is regulated by the Pharmacy Council of India (PCI) and offered by over 330 colleges, both government and private. Students gain skills in drug safety, patient counseling, and regulatory compliance, making them vital to the healthcare ecosystem.

B Pharma Admission in Uttar Pradesh 2025
B Pharma admission in Uttar Pradesh 2025 is primarily managed through the
Uttar Pradesh Technical Admission Counselling (UPTAC), conducted by
Dr. A.P.J. Abdul Kalam Technical University (AKTU). The process is centralized,
transparent, and based on national/state-level entrance exams. Some colleges also
offer direct admissions for vacant seats.
Eligibility Criteria
First Year:
- 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ics/Biology (PCM/PCB).
- Minimum 50% aggregate marks (45% for SC/ST).
- Valid CUET UG 2025 score (mandatory for UPTAC counseling).
- UP domicile or parents domiciled in UP (non-domicile candidates need a domicile certificate).
Lateral Entry (2nd Year):
- Diploma in Pharmacy from a PCI-approved institution.
- Minimum 50% aggregate (45% for SC/ST).
- CUET UG 2025 or JEECUP score.
- Limited to 10% of the previous year’s first-year intake.
Admission Process
The UPTAC counseling process for B Pharma admission in Uttar Pradesh 2025 includes the following steps:
- Online Registration: Register on uptac.admissions.nic.in with CUET UG/JEECUP details (₹1,000 non-refundable fee).
- Document Upload: Submit 10+2/diploma mark sheets, entrance scorecard, domicile/category certificates, and photo/signature.
- Document Verification: Online verification by UPTAC authorities; candidates are notified via SMS/email.
- Choice Filling: Select preferred colleges and B.Pharm programs from the available list.
- Seat Allotment: Based on CUET UG/JEECUP rank, preferences, and reservations; results published online.
- Seat Acceptance: Pay ₹20,000 (General/OBC) or ₹12,000 (SC/ST) to confirm the seat, adjustable against college fees.
- Physical Reporting: Visit the allotted college with original documents for final verification and enrollment.
Direct Admission:
Some private colleges (e.g., Lloyd Institute, Maharishi University) offer merit-based admissions for candidates with 45–60% in 10+2, often requiring a personal interview.
Key Dates (Tentative):
- Registration: June 2025
- Choice Filling: July–August 2025
- Seat Allotment (Round 1): September 2025
- Subsequent Rounds: October–November 2025
Check uptac.admissions.nic.in for the official 2025 schedule.
B Pharma Fees in Uttar Pradesh Colleges
B Pharma fees in Uttar Pradesh colleges vary based on institution type, with government colleges being more affordable than private ones. Below is an overview:
Institution Type |
Fee Range (₹, 4 Years) |
Examples |
Government |
62,000–3,00,000 |
IIT BHU (2,00,000–3,00,000), CSJMU Jhansi (3,00,000) |
Private |
2,00,000–8,80,000 |
Amity University (8,80,000), Lloyd Institute (5,23,000) |
Additional Costs
- UPTAC Counseling: ₹1,000 registration + ₹12,000–₹20,000 seat acceptance fee.
- Hostel Fees: ₹1,00,000–₹2,00,000 annually (varies by college).
- Other Fees: Lab charges, library fees, and exam fees may apply.
- Scholarships: Available for meritorious students, SC/ST, EWS, and UP residents. Colleges like KIET, Integral University, and Lloyd offer merit-based and need-based scholarships, while UP government schemes support low-income families.
Cost Insight: 75% of B Pharma colleges in Uttar Pradesh have annual fees between ₹2–3 lakh, offering good value for money given the placement outcomes.
Career Prospects After B Pharma
A B Pharma degree opens doors to diverse career paths in pharmaceuticals, healthcare, and research. Graduates from Uttar Pradesh colleges benefit from strong industry connections and placement support. Here are key career opportunities:
- Pharmacist: Dispense medications in hospitals or retail pharmacies (₹2.5–₹4 lakh per annum).
- Quality Control Analyst: Ensure drug safety and efficacy (₹3–₹4.5 lakh per annum).
- Clinical Research Associate: Conduct drug trials and research (₹3.5–₹5 lakh per annum).
- Regulatory Affairs Specialist: Ensure compliance with health regulations (₹4–₹6 lakh per annum).
- Drug Inspector: Monitor drug quality and safety (₹4–₹7 lakh per annum).
- Pharmaceutical Entrepreneur: Start pharmacies or consulting firms after licensure.
Higher Studies:
- M.Pharm in Pharmaceutics, Pharmacology, or Pharmaceutical Chemistry.
- Pharm.D or Ph.D. for research and academia.
- MBA in Healthcare Management for leadership roles.
- MS in Pharmacy abroad via GRE/TOEFL/IELTS.
Global Opportunities:
Graduates can register as pharmacists in the USA, Canada, or Australia after clearing licensure exams, leveraging India’s reputation as the “pharmacy of the world.”
